Is it possible to have a nose fracture and not notice?

0

I had a broken nose for years without realizing it. It wasn’t until after years of recurring sinus infections & vertigo, and a multitude of other symptoms that I found out what it was. It caused me so many problems that it almost killed me. Usually deviated septums are harmless, & can go untreated for years. Usually it is left alone unless you begin to have recurring sinus infections like I did. This resulted in surgery to repair the septum because the bones collapsed, causing numorous other problems. After surgery for a deviated septum, & 3 sinus surgeries I am now feeling so much better. I hope your’s doesn’t cause you problems like mine did. It can be pretty miserable. Goodluck to you!
